This big book of stained glass coloring fun proclaims joy to the world with 48 holiday images. Designs range from sacred to secular, with angels and wise men as well as carolers, snowflakes, and a trip to Santa's workshop. Depictions of The Twelve Days of Christmas add a special note of seasonal cheer.

I bought this book for my daughter around the Christmas season and we both had a blast with it. The paper is sheer and can be filled in with crayons, markers, water colors, etc. The stained glass sketches are very beautiful and intricate, but it's almost impossible to "mess up" a picture, so kids can color in with confidence.
Also, the pages tear out easily and can be hung in front of windows. We did this in my daughter's bedroom and the images are truly pretty, especially when the sun shines through them. It's well past Christmas but we still enjoy coloring these panels together. This is a wonderful activity for parents and kids. I dare any parent to not be tempted to color their own panel. It's lots of fun. Also good for kids of varying ages and skill levels.
